Company Description
Prepaire Labs is a groundbreaking healthcare technology company revolutionizing drug discovery and precision medicine through the integration of deep learning and biology. Leveraging genetic, phenotypic, and clinical data, Prepaire Labs develops predictive models to understand disease architecture and biology. Utilizing advanced techniques such as iPSCs, genome editing, and high-content phenotyping, the company creates in vitro disease models to improve clinical outcome predictability. Its state-of-the-art BSL3 lab, set to open in May 2025 in Masdar City, Abu Dhabi, UAE, will provide a fully automated Lab As A Service (LAAS) with cutting-edge capabilities, including organoid bio-network printing and microfluidic devices.
THE IDEAL CANDIDATE: CLEVERGUM FORMULATION LEAD
This person sits at the intersection of bioconjugation chemistry, peptide science, nanoformulation, buccal drug delivery, and hardcore problem solving. They must be senior, not “learning on the job.”
Think someone who could walk into Ardena, Bachem, or a Karolinska peptide lab and operate day one.
Core Identity
A senior Bioconjugation / Peptide Formulation Chemist with:
· Deep command of click chemistry (CuAAC, SPAAC, Tetrazine–TCO).
· Hands-on experience with peptide synthesis and PEGylation, including troubleshooting failed modifications.
· Strong grasp of LNP design: encapsulation efficiency, particle sizing, lipid ratios, stability testing.
· Experience with buccal or mucosal delivery systems, or at minimum oral/transmucosal barriers and permeation enhancers.
· Ability to manage external CRO partners (like LifeTein, BOC Sciences, Ardena) and to challenge their recommendations intelligently.
· A “weaponized detail-oriented” mindset: nothing slips; everything gets validated.
This person must fully understand the technical workflow, including conjugation, peptide mapping, nanoparticle compatibility, and controlled release on buccal mucosa. They need to execute decisions decisively without drifting into theory.
Required Hard Skills
1. Click Chemistry & Bioconjugation
Must be fluent in:
· SPAAC, IEDDA (tetrazine ligation), CuAAC
· Linker stability under acid and saliva conditions
· PEG linkers, cleavable linkers, self-immolative linkers
· Cys conjugation, maleimide chemistry, N3/DBCO strategies
Our current pipeline explicitly requires this level of command.
2. Peptide Chemistry / Conjugation
· Solid-phase peptide synthesis troubleshooting
· PEGylation of peptides for stability and PK enhancement
· Conjugation to ligands, aptamers, or ADC components
· Purification via HPLC, MCSGP, PEC methodologies
· Characterization (HPLC, LC-MS, DLS)
3. Nanoparticle Formulation
Our platform depends on someone who can independently validate:
· Lipid composition screening
· Encapsulation efficiency >90%
· Particle stability in simulated saliva and under mechanical stress
· Mucoadhesive polymers (chitosan, pectin)
· Release kinetics in Franz diffusion cells
4. Buccal Delivery & Stability
They must understand:
· Enzymatic threats in oral mucosa
· pH stability windows
· Mechanical shear tolerance
· Diffusion limitations of peptides across mucosa
· Use of permeation enhancers and inhibitors
5. Cross-functional Execution
They must be comfortable coordinating with:
· LifeTein (custom click conjugation and PEGylation)
· BOC (LNP validation pipeline)
· Prepaire (in vitro and computational modeling)
· Ardena (CMC and scale-up issues)
